Uintah Basin Rehabilitation And Senior Villa in Roosevelt, UT is best suited for families that prioritize heartfelt, hands-on caregiving from a devoted staff. This community works for seniors who respond well to personal attention, warm interactions, and nursing teams that truly seem to care about residents' daily comfort. It is a fit for families that are willing to stay engaged, advocate actively, and accept some variability in operations as the price of consistently compassionate care. If the primary need is reliable, flawless administrative execution and robust safety systems, this community may not be the strongest match.
Those evaluating alternatives should note who may want to look elsewhere. Residents who require consistently prompt phone communication, uninterrupted safety features, and dependable, streamlined management will likely find better alignment elsewhere. The most frequent concerns center on communication reliability, safety provisions in rooms, and timely medical responsiveness. Families should also consider whether the quality of daily meals and the overall dining experience meet their expectations, since these factors significantly affect daily life and satisfaction.
On the positive side, the strongest recurring theme is the character of the caregiving staff. Multiple accounts describe staff as caring, kind, and going above and beyond for residents. Nursing personnel are frequently praised for their attentiveness and the genuine warmth they bring to daily care tasks. When care is needed in the moment, many families report that nurses and aides show real dedication and compassion, which can translate into noticeable emotional and relational benefits for residents who value personal connection.
Yet the negative threads cannot be ignored, and they cut against the caregiving strengths. The most consistent concerns revolve around accessibility and reliability: phones not being answered promptly, which leaves families fearing communication gaps; night staff behavior described as loud and disruptive; and general inattention at times that leads to delays in pain management and other basic needs. Extreme examples recount inadequate pain control, delayed medication administration, and even safety issues such as beds without adequate rails. Meal service is frequently criticized, with menus seen as impersonal and the actual meals not meeting expectations for flavor or variety.
These pros and cons must be weighed carefully. The exceptional care and genuine kindness of staff can offset many day-to-day frustrations for residents who do not require 24/7 clinical dependability or high-stakes medical oversight. For a senior who can be supervised by family or a trusted advocate, and who thrives on relational warmth, the emotional and personal support may outweigh operational shortcomings. However, for residents recovering from surgery, managing acute pain, or needing strict safety controls, the safety and care gaps described are meaningful red flags that should shift the decision toward alternatives with stronger medical management and more reliable daily operations.
Practical next steps are essential for families considering this option. Request a live tour during routine operations to observe how the staff interact with residents and how call bells are answered. Inquire specifically about pain management protocols, nursing oversight, and how quickly staff respond to urgent needs at night. Inspect sleeping areas for safety features - rails, bed dimensions, and room layout - and verify the availability of assistive devices. Sample the menu with a critical eye toward flavor, variety, and dietary accommodations. Talk directly with current residents or families about consistency of care and responsiveness. Finally, compare with nearby communities that offer stronger safety infrastructure and more consistent meal quality to determine whether warmth and compassion alone justify the trade-offs.
The Uintah Basin Rehabilitation And Senior Villa in Roosevelt, UT is an assisted living community that offers a range of amenities and care services to meet the needs of its residents. The community provides a comfortable and welcoming environment for seniors to enjoy their retirement years.
Residents of the senior villa have access to numerous amenities that enhance their daily lives. A beauty salon is available on-site for personal grooming needs, and cable or satellite TV ensures entertainment options are readily available. Community operated transportation makes it easy for residents to get around town, whether it be for errands or social outings. A computer center allows residents to stay connected with loved ones or pursue personal interests online.
Dining at this community is a restaurant-style experience in a shared dining room, where delicious meals are prepared and served by the staff. Special dietary restrictions can be accommodated, ensuring that each resident's nutritional needs are met.
Engaging in regular physical activity is made easy with the fitness room, where residents can participate in exercise programs tailored to their abilities and interests. For those looking for leisure activities, there is a gaming room, small library, and outdoor spaces such as gardens where residents can relax and enjoy nature.
Care services provided by trained staff ensure that residents receive assistance with various activities of daily living, such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. Medication management is also available to help individuals maintain their health and well-being. The mental wellness program aims to support emotional well-being through various activities and therapies.
A variety of activities are offered for residents' enjoyment. Concierge services are available to assist with planning day trips or arranging resident-run activities within the community. Daily activities are scheduled to provide opportunities for socialization and engagement.
The senior villa also benefits from its convenient location near c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, places of worship, theaters, hospitals, and transportation options. This allows residents easy access to necessary amenities and services outside of the community.
Overall, the Uintah Basin Rehabilitation And Senior Villa provides a comprehensive range of amenities and care services in a comfortable environment, ensuring that residents can enjoy their retirement years with peace of mind and support.
This area of Roosevelt, Utah, offers a variety of amenities that may appeal to seniors looking for a convenient and vibrant community. With several restaurants nearby, such as Echo Drive In and EL Sombrero, there are plenty of dining options to choose from. Additionally, the presence of multiple places of worship, including churches like Southern Baptist Convention and Jehovah's Witness Kingdom Hall, provides opportunities for spiritual fulfillment. For medical needs, there are hospitals like Uintah Basin Medical Center and physicians like Northeastern Utah Medical Group in close proximity. Parks like Centennial Park offer opportunities for outdoor recreation, while cafes like Greenhouse Coffee provide spaces for socializing and relaxation. Theaters such as Uinta Theatre also offer entertainment options. Overall, this part of Roosevelt offers a range of services and resources that may make it an appealing choice for senior living.
